Invoke-CimMethod -ClassName Win32_Operatingsystem … Web1: Task Manager Open the Task Manager and click on More Details. Click on the User tab. Right-click on the user and click on Sign off. 2: Command Prompt Open the Command Prompt or PowerShell and type in query session to list all users. Take note of the ID of the person you want to log off. To log someone off, type in logoff ID replacing ID with the ID …

WebIf you use Group Policy and OUs, you will be able to allow some users to stay "disconnected" and force others to log-off after disconnect. Specifically check out these policy branches: Computer Configuration\Policies\Administrative Templates\Windows Components\Remote Desktop Services\Remote Desktop Session Host\Session Time Limits

Open up Task Manager by pressing Ctrl+Shift+Esc, then click the “Users” tab at the top of the window. Select the user you want to sign out, and then click “Sign Out” at the bottom of the window. Alternatively, right-click on the user and then click “Sign Off” on the context menu.
